Mastering The Rotator Cuff: A Sports-Based Workshop for Practical Best Practice Management (2 CE)

Rotator cuff injuries account for 4.5 million physician office visits per year. Management of this problem can range from frustrating to rewarding, depending on the depth of training. This practical workshop outlines everything you need to know about successfully treating rotator cuff pathology. This workshop will take you through the latest best practices for evaluation, treatment, and home rehab. You'll learn how to approach each case confidently and leave with a greater understanding of managing the most common problem affecting the shoulder.

Dr. Steele is currently in private practice at Premier Rehab in the greater St. Louis area. He began his career with a post-graduate residency at The Central Institute for Human Performance. During this unique opportunity, he was able to create and implement rehabilitation programs for members of the St. Louis Cardinals, Blues, and Rams. Dr. Steele currently lectures extensively on clinical excellence and evidence-based treatment of musculoskeletal disorders. He serves on the executive board of the Illinois Chiropractic Society. He is a Diplomate and Fellow of the Academy of Chiropractic Orthopedists (FACO). Brandon is co-founder of the online clinical resource ChiroUp.com.
